I just got a new fuse block put on by the Chevy Dealership. A few days after I got it back I went to start my truck and I lost power to everything. When I turn the key to the position right before you start it my fuel pump kicked on and everything was normal, but when I turned it all the way over to start it that is when everything went dead. I went and checked voltage on my battery and the battery is good and so are the battery terminal connections. I went and tried to start the truck like five minutes later and it started right up. I don't want it to do this again. What could it have been to make my truck loose power to everything.
